Answer:
x=4
Step-by-step explanation:
f(x) = (x-2)^5 +3
Let f(x) = 35
35 = (x-2)^5 +3
Subtract 3 from each side
35-3 = (x-2)^5 +3-3
32 = (x-2)^5
Take the fifth root of each side
32 ^ (1/5) = (x-2)^5^ 1/5
2 = x-2
Add 2 to each side
2 +2 = x-2+2
4 =x
